Quote:

Originally Posted by Mordiganne (Post 807440)
One of Hasbro's early mistakes (that they've now corrected) was underestimating the customizing market. I spend more on MU figures in a year now then I did the entire time I was just collecting. Because the only way to get parts is to buy more bodies. Hasbro caught on to that (eventually) which is why they started packing alternate character heads in with the figures instead of making a whole extra figure on its own and selling it with that head. Because people will buy more of the base figure to get another body to stick the head on. It's a great business model that the idiot bean counters ignored for years.

Agreed. i find myself back-collecting MU figures not just for customizing but also because they are out of production. While finding them in various non-retail stores like local comic/hobby shops and flea markets, i must confess i miss seeing them in an actual toy aisle.
